Output dbfa82adff83442341e20415b84bae6ee4ed4caf9a81f21be5bbbf9b7e5ec2bb:2

value
20370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3a35189574b37d48694b8fefddb2bd89c176a5 OP_EQUAL
address
3JwZN7yy7HyAHCZsSdX77femCxhRiVgPPg
transaction
dbfa82adff83442341e20415b84bae6ee4ed4caf9a81f21be5bbbf9b7e5ec2bb
confirmations
278170
spent
true